Ontonagon County, Michigan Property Taxes
Census Bureau ACS property tax data for Michigan. Population: 2,599.
The median annual property tax in Ontonagon County is $1,244, which is 41% lower than the Michigan state average and 35% below the national average. The effective tax rate is 1.23% on a median home value of $101,000. Property taxes represent 2.4% of the median household income in this county.

Property Tax History
| Year | Median Tax | Effective Rate |
|---|---|---|
| 2023 | $1,244 +5.6% | 1.23% |
| 2022 | $1,178 +9.9% | 1.31% |
| 2021 | $1,072 -1.0% | 1.40% |
| 2020 | $1,083 +1.0% | 1.46% |
| 2019 | $1,072 | 1.53% |

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the average property tax in Ontonagon County, Michigan? ▼
The median annual property tax in Ontonagon County is $1,244 based on the most recent Census Bureau American Community Survey data. The effective tax rate is 1.23% on a median home value of $101,000.
How does Ontonagon County property tax compare to the national average? ▼
Property taxes in Ontonagon County are 35% below the national average of $1,923. The effective rate of 1.23% compares to 0.95% nationally.
Does having a mortgage affect property taxes in Ontonagon County? ▼
In Ontonagon County, homeowners with a mortgage pay a median of $1,359 in annual property taxes, while homeowners without a mortgage pay $1,191. This difference often reflects the value of homes rather than different tax rates.
What percentage of income goes to property taxes in Ontonagon County? ▼
Property taxes in Ontonagon County represent approximately 2.4% of the median household income of $51,844. The national benchmark is generally 2-4% of household income.
